Requirements
| Requirement | Details |
|---|
| Runtime | Python 3.6+ (uses only standard library: urllib, json, os, re, sys, time) |
| External packages | None — zero pip install required |
| Environment variables | HIGHLEVEL_TOKEN (Primary — your Private Integration bearer token) |
| HIGHLEVEL_LOCATION_ID (your sub-account Location ID) |
| Network access | HTTPS to services.leadconnectorhq.com only |
Base URL: https://services.leadconnectorhq.com
Required Headers: Authorization: Bearer $HIGHLEVEL_TOKEN + Version: 2021-07-28
Rate Limits: 100 requests/10 seconds burst, 200K/day per location
Security Design
All API functions use pre-defined endpoint paths — there is no arbitrary HTTP request capability. Every user-supplied ID is validated against a strict alphanumeric regex (^[a-zA-Z0-9_-]{1,128}$) before being included in any URL path, preventing path traversal and injection. The scripts use only Python's built-in urllib.request for all network calls. No shell commands, no external binaries, no file writes outside of stdout.

Manual Setup (if wizard can't run)
Step 1: Create a Private Integration (NOT the old API Keys method)
-
Log into app.gohighlevel.com
-
Switch to your Sub-Account (recommended for single-location use)
-
Click Settings (bottom-left gear icon)
-
Select Private Integrations in the left sidebar
- If not visible, enable it first: Settings → Labs → toggle Private Integrations ON
-
Click "Create new Integration"
-
Enter a name (e.g., "Claude AI Assistant") and description
-
Grant only the scopes you need (least-privilege recommended):
| Use case | Recommended scopes |
|---|
| Contact management only | contacts.readonly, contacts.write |
| Contacts + messaging | Above + conversations.readonly, conversations.write, conversations/message.write |
| Full CRM (contacts, calendar, pipeline) | Above + calendars.readonly, calendars.write, opportunities.readonly, opportunities.write |
| Adding workflows & invoices | Above + workflows.readonly, invoices.readonly, invoices.write |
| Read-only reporting | contacts.readonly, opportunities.readonly, calendars.readonly, invoices.readonly, locations.readonly |
You can always add more scopes later in Settings → Private Integrations → Edit without regenerating the token.
-
Click Create → Copy the token IMMEDIATELY — it is shown only once and cannot be retrieved later
Agency vs Sub-Account Integrations
| Feature | Agency Integration | Sub-Account Integration |
|---|
| Created at | Agency Settings → Private Integrations | Sub-Account Settings → Private Integrations |
| Access scope | Agency + all sub-accounts (pass locationId) | Single location only |
| Available scopes | All scopes including locations.write, oauth.*, saas.*, snapshots.*, companies.readonly | Sub-account scopes only |
| Best for | Multi-location management, SaaS configurator | Single client integrations (recommended default) |
Recommendation: Start with a Sub-Account integration and the minimum scopes you need. You can upgrade to Agency-level later if you need multi-location access.
Step 2: Get Your Location ID
- While in the sub-account, go to Settings → Business Info (or Business Profile)
- The Location ID is displayed in the General Information section
- Alternative: check the URL bar — it's the ID after
/location/ in app.gohighlevel.com/v2/location/{LOCATION_ID}/...
Step 3: Set Environment Variables
export HIGHLEVEL_TOKEN="your-private-integration-token"
export HIGHLEVEL_LOCATION_ID="your-location-id"
Step 4: Test Connection
Run python3 scripts/ghl-api.py test_connection — should return location name and status.
After successful setup, pull 5 contacts as a quick win to confirm everything works.

Important Notes
- Private Integrations are required — the old Settings → API Keys method is deprecated/EOL
- Token rotation: Tokens don't auto-expire but GHL recommends 90-day rotation. Unused tokens auto-expire after 90 days inactivity
- "Rotate and expire later" — new token generated, old token stays active for 7-day grace period
- "Rotate and expire now" — old token invalidated immediately (use for compromised credentials)
- You can edit scopes without regenerating the token
- OAuth tokens (marketplace apps only): Access tokens expire in 24 hours (86,399s); refresh tokens last up to 1 year
- Agency tokens can access sub-account data by passing
locationId parameter
- Rate limits are per-resource — each sub-account independently gets 100/10s burst + 200K/day. SaaS endpoints: 10 req/sec global
- All list endpoints default to 20 records, max 100 per page via
limit param
- Use cursor pagination with
startAfter / startAfterId for large datasets
- Monitor rate limits via response headers:
X-RateLimit-Limit-Daily, X-RateLimit-Daily-Remaining, X-RateLimit-Max, X-RateLimit-Remaining, X-RateLimit-Interval-Milliseconds
- $497 Agency Pro plan required for: SaaS Configurator, Snapshots, full agency management APIs
Webhook Events
50+ webhook event types for real-time notifications. Key events: ContactCreate, ContactDelete, ContactTagUpdate, InboundMessage, OutboundMessage, OpportunityCreate, OpportunityStageUpdate, OpportunityStatusUpdate, appointment events, payment events, form submission events. Webhooks continue firing even if access token expires. Config is per marketplace app.
